Job Summary

Manager of Strategic Projects in Growth Operations leads quantitative deep-dives for C-suite decisions on long-range planning, portfolio prioritization, and resource allocation. You will translate forecasts into downstream implications, run cross-functional strategy sprints, build planning frameworks and models, and present executive recommendations to drive growth and scale.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Own ad-hoc strategic projects from C-suite that directly impact top-line growth strategy and business expansion.
  • •Run strategic sprints on downstream planning related to the ACV forecast including tie-in with long-term strategic plans, product mix, and enabling manufacturing and delivery capacity at the targeted pace.
  • •Lead scenario planning efforts to model different growth trajectories, government program office trends, and strategic options for leadership decision-making.
  • •Build and refine planning frameworks, forecasting models, and analytical tools used by growth leadership.
  • •Translate complex analyses into clear, actionable recommendations for executive audiences.

Key Requirements

  • •4+ years of experience in investment banking, management consulting, corporate strategy, or a high-growth operational role.
  • •Strong quantitative and analytical skills with demonstrated experience in forecasting, financial modeling, and scenario analysis.
  • •Proven track record of owning complex, ambiguous initiatives with measurable business impact.
  • •Excellent executive communication skills, including the ability to distill sophisticated analyses into clear insights and influence senior stakeholders.
  • •High ownership mindset with a bias toward action and ability to drive projects to completion.

Company Brief

Anduril
Designs and builds advanced defense systems combining autonomous aircraft, sensors, and AI-driven software for military and national security applications, focused on modernizing battlefield capabilities and distributed sensing.
